Vintage 1981 Rolex Submariner Date Ref. 16800
Rolex's Submariner is synonymous with the concept of a tool watch, and at the same time a classic design icon and one of the most important watches ever made. The Submariner's evolution took an important step with the reference 16800, which was the first Submariner with a quickset date feature, a ratcheting unidirectional bezel, and a sapphire crystal. The early examples of the 16800 also retained the matte black dial from the previous generation until 1984 when Rolex made the change to gloss dials with white gold marker surrounds, making the early 16800 the only matte dial/sapphire crystal/quickset Sub.
That distinction is important because this is a watch that retains all of the vintage Rolex charm with some more modern technology and convenience included, making it excellently suited to, well, actually wearing than just keeping in a safe out of fear of ruining hard-to-find vintage Rolex acrylic crystals. Case: 40mm stainless steel case with a 7.20 million serial number dating production to approximately 1981. The case is in excellent condition and has seen minimal polishing.
Bezel: 120 click unidirectional bezel in excellent condition as pictured. The bezel insert has some minor surface marks but very minimal paint loss.

Dial/Hands: Original matte black dial with painted tritium markers. Hour plots have developed pleasing light, even patina. The hands are also original with matching tritium patina and some very light wear as pictured. 

Crystal: Original sapphire crystal in good condition as pictured. The crystal has some very minor nicks on the crystal edge and light surface marks visible in certain light that do not affect the view of the dial or water resistance.
Caseback: Original caseback in very good condition as shown.

Movement: Original Caliber 3035 movement in excellent condition that winds, runs, and sets time as it should. Timekeeping is excellent although service history is unknown. 

Strap: Original 93150 bracelet with "G" clasp code and 563 end links and 11 links. Bracelet shows minor scratching consistent with wear and has only very light stretch.
